#df2ed4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#df2ed4 is composed of 87.5% red, 18%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.4% magenta, 4.9%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 303.7 degrees, a saturation of 73.4% and a lightness of 52.7%. #df2ed4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5cff with #bf00a9.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#df2ed4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c020c is the darkest color, while #fefafe is the lightest one.
